Estimating time of arrival of trains at level crossings for the provision of multimodal cooperative services

2020 
Abstract While cooperative services have been almost fully deployed in the road sector and are already being implemented in various cities in Europe as a pre-requisite for the introduction of autonomous vehicles, few attempts have been made in the same direction for the rail sector. This study proposes a system that aims to improve safety and minimize risk in the meeting point between road and rail, known as level crossings, by monitoring the location of floating road vehicles via a mobile device application. A neural network predictive model for estimating time of arrival of trains is also utilized. The safety system has been implemented and tested under real life conditions in the city of Thessaloniki, Greece.
